- iPaaS三方执行动作
- 会员通
- 积分通
- 商品通
- 导购通
- 电子卡券通
- 订单通
- 储值通
- 优惠券通
- 基础组件
- 库存通
- 标签通
- 门店通
- 分销员通
- 权益卡通
- 试用单通
- StockQueryExtension
退款单状态更新
POST
/OrderRefundStatusChangeExtension
请求参数
Body 参数application/json
rootKdtId
integer <int64>
有赞店铺总部Id
appId
string
必需
globalProps
object (Map«Object»)
全局变量
key
object (key)
可选
extendMap
object (Map«Object»)
必需
key
object (key)
可选
refundOrderItem
array[object (RefundOrderItem) {7}]
退款子订单信息
oid
string
退款明细id
outOid
string
外部订单ID
refundFee
integer <int64>
可选
itemNum
integer
退款商品数量
shipped
boolean
是否已发货
subOrderItemNum
integer
子订单商品数量
itemIdentity
object (ItemIdentity)
商品身份
refundFunds
array[object (RefundFund) {7}]
退款资金信息
status
integer
可选
refundId
string
退款ID
payWay
integer
可选
message
string
错误信息
refundMode
integer
可选
refundNo
string
退款流水号
refundFee
integer <int64>
可选
modified
string
可选
desc
string
售后说明
refundTicketNum
integer
可选
consultMessages
array[object (ConsultMessage) {3}]
凭证信息
kdtId
integer <int64>
店铺id
orderNo
string
订单号
attachment
array[string]
凭证
kdtId
integer <int64>
可选
demand
integer
可选
refundTicketList
array[string]
退款卡券ID列表
refundFee
integer <int64>
可选
refundFundDesc
string
退款资金说明
created
string
可选
returnGoods
boolean
可选
reason
integer
可选
质量问题;12: 拍错/多拍/不喜欢;13: 商品描述不符;14: 假货;15: 商家发错货;16: 商品破损/少件;17: 其他;18: 仅退款(收到货)-退运费;19:
协商一致退款;20: 快递一直未送达;21: 未按约定时间发货;22: 拍错/不想要;23: 计划有变无法使用;24: 商家降价; (仅退款-未收到货申请原因) 25:非正品 51:
买错/多买/不想要;52: 快递无记录;53: 少货/空包裹;54: 未按约定时间发货;55: 快递一直未送达;56: 其他;57: 拍错/多拍/不喜欢;58:
(退货退款-申请原因)协商一致退款; 59: 同城订单商家手动拒单;60:仅退款(未收到货) -地址/电话填错了 ;61:仅退款(未收到货) -送达时间选错了;101:
商品破损/少件;102: 商家发错货;103: 商品描 述不符;104: 拍错/多拍/不喜欢;105: 质量问题;106: 假货;107: 其他;108: 做工粗糙/有瑕疵;109:
非正品;110: (系统退款原因) 未按约定时间发货;111:退货退款-退运费;112:7天无理由退货;201: 返现退款;202:203:拼团订单扣库存失败退款;
酒店拒单退款;204: 订单关闭退款;205: 代付过期退款;206: 超付退款;207: 外卖拒单退款;208: 拼团未成团退款;209: 团购返现退款;210:美业退款;211:
订单少付退款;212:
小程序拼团退款;213:送礼子订单未被领取退款;214:超付+本金组合退款;215:送礼社群版到期自动退款;216:上云商家一键退款类型;217:群团购团长审核不通过退款;218:群团购未成团退款;219:会员卡发卡失败退款;220:同城订单超时未接单自动关单;221:差价退款;222:重复购买退款;223:教育线上重复购买退款;301:换货-商家发错商品;302:换货-大小/颜色/型号不合适;303:换货-商品损坏;304:换货-其他;401:酒店退款-行程取消;402:酒店退款-信息填错;403:酒店退款-前台价格更优惠;404:酒店退款-其他渠道更便宜;405:酒店退款-对酒店环境不满意;406:酒店退款-卖家告诉满房;407:酒店退款-买多了/买错了/计划有变;408:酒店退款-想要预约的日期预约不上;409:酒店退款-直接预订的价格比使用预售券更优惠;410:酒店退款-预约时联系不上商家;411:酒店退款-商品信息与实际信息不符;412:酒店退款-其他.
refundAccountTime
string <date-time>
退款到账时间
refundPostage
integer <int64>
可选
logistics
object (Logistics)
物流信息
companyCode
string
可选
address
string
收件人地址
logisticsNo
string
可选
mobile
string
收件人电话
receiver
string
收件人
version
integer <int64>
可选
oid
string
可选
refundId
string
可选
outRefundId
string
外部维权单id
refundType
string
可选
BUYER_APPLY_REFUND(买家申请退款),SELLER_REFUND(商家主动退款),EXCHANGE_GOODS(买家申请换货),SYSTEM_REFUND(一键退款,特殊类型退款。如超卖,支付回调超时)
status
string
可选
WAIT_SELLER_CONFIRM_GOODS-买家已经退货,等待卖家确认收货; SELLER_REFUSE_BUYER-卖家拒绝退款;
SELLER_REFUSE_BUYER_RETURN_GOODS-卖家未收到货,拒绝退款 ;
SELLER_RETURN_GOODS-商家确认收货并发送换货;CLOSED-退款关闭;SUCCESS-退款成功;
orderInfo
object (OrderInfo)
主订单信息
tid
string
可选
outTid
string
外部订单号
payType
integer
支付类型
expressType
integer
可选
type
integer
可选
9:品鉴; 10:拼团; 15:返利; 35:酒店; 40:外卖; 41:堂食点餐; 46:外卖买单; 51:全员开店; 61:线下收银台订单; 71:美业预约单; 72:美业服务单;
75:知识付费; 81:礼品卡;85:直播带货订单(仅指爱逛平台产生的订单);89-样品订单;100:批发
refundState
integer
可选
updateTime
string <date-time>
可选
consignTime
string <date-time>
可选
payTime
string <date-time>
可选
successTime
string <date-time>
可选
closeType
integer
可选
12:买家无诚意完成交易; 13:已通过银行线下汇款; 14:已通过同城见面交易; 15:已通过货到付款交易; 16:已通过网上银行直接汇款; 17:已经缺货无法交易; 18:扣款失败;
19:0元关单; 20:社区团购活动结束未付款; 21:0元抽奖订单未中一等奖; 22:拒单退款;
payTypeStr
string
可选
channelType
integer
可选
91:腾讯慧聚,100:CRM 订单导入后不在有赞商城里面展示,也不能对其进行操作,只在CRM里面展示,
110:通用三方 适用于大客、ERP等导入,订单导入后会在有赞商城后台展示,商家能够操作发、退款等,120:饿了么餐饮系统"
status
string
可选
,该状态仅代表当前订单已支付成功,表示瞬时状态,稍后会自动修改成后面的状态。如果不关心此状态请再次请求详情接口获取下一个状态,
WAIT_CONFIRM:待确认,包含待成团、待接单等等。即:买家已付款,等待成团或等待接单, WAIT_SELLER_SEND_GOODS:等待卖家发货,即:买家已付款,
WAIT_BUYER_CONFIRM_GOODS 等待买家确认收货,即:卖家已发货, TRADE_SUCCESS:买家已签收以及订单成功, TRADE_CLOSED:交易关闭
created
string <date-time>
可选
packingChargeInfo
object (PackingChargeInfo)
打包费信息
buyerInfo
object (BuyerInfo)
购买人信息
outerUserId
string
可选
buyerPhone
string
可选
buyerId
integer <int64>
买家id
nickname
string
昵称
yzOpenId
string
有赞客户id
outOpenId
string
三方客户id
sellerInfo
object (SellerInfo)
卖家信息
nodeKdtId
integer <int64>
可选
shopDisplayNo
string
门店编码
shopName
string
店铺名称
outStoreId
string
三方门店ID
outStoreCode
string
可选
tel
string
卖家手机号
subOrders
array[object (SubOrderItem) {21}]
原单子订单信息
itemIdentity
object (ItemIdentity)
商品身份
alias
string
商品别名
totalFee
integer <int64>
可选
num
integer
商品数量
oid
string
订单明细id
outOid
string
外部子订单号
buyerMessages
string
商品留言
pointsPrice
string
可选
price
integer <int64>
可选
isPresent
boolean
可选
promotionDiscount
string
优惠
goodsCostPrice
integer <int64>
可选
itemType
integer
可选
31:知识付费商品; 35:酒店商品; 40:普通服务类商品; 71:卡项商品;182:普通 虚拟商品; 183:电子卡券商品; 201:外部会员卡商品; 202:外部直接收款商品;
203:外部普通商品; 204:外部服务商品;205:mock不存在商品; 206:小程序二维码;207:积分充值商品;208:付费优惠券商品
title
string
商品名称
picPath
string
商品图片地址
payment
integer <int64>
可选
discountPrice
integer <int64>
可选
weight
number
重量(单位:kg)
itemSalesStaffs
array[object (ItemSalesStaff) {4}]
商品导购员工编号
skuAttributes
array[object (SkuAttribute) {2}]
可选
itemProps
string
商品属性
示例
{
"rootKdtId": 0,
"appId": "string",
"globalProps": {
"key": {}
},
"extendMap": {
"key": {}
},
"refundOrderItem": [
{
"oid": "string",
"outOid": "string",
"refundFee": 0,
"itemNum": 0,
"shipped": true,
"subOrderItemNum": 0,
"itemIdentity": {
"itemId": 0,
"rootItemId": 0,
"outItemId": "string",
"itemNo": "string",
"itemBarcode": "string",
"skuNo": "string",
"skuId": 0,
"rootSkuId": 0,
"outSkuId": "string",
"skuBarcode": "string",
"skuUniqueCode": "string"
}
}
],
"refundFunds": [
{
"status": 0,
"refundId": "string",
"payWay": 0,
"message": "string",
"refundMode": 0,
"refundNo": "string",
"refundFee": 0
}
],
"modified": "string",
"desc": "string",
"refundTicketNum": 0,
"consultMessages": [
{
"kdtId": 0,
"orderNo": "string",
"attachment": [
"string"
]
}
],
"kdtId": 0,
"demand": 0,
"refundTicketList": [
"string"
],
"refundFee": 0,
"refundFundDesc": "string",
"created": "string",
"returnGoods": true,
"reason": 0,
"refundAccountTime": "2019-08-24T14:15:22Z",
"refundPostage": 0,
"logistics": {
"companyCode": "string",
"address": "string",
"logisticsNo": "string",
"mobile": "string",
"receiver": "string"
},
"version": 0,
"oid": "string",
"refundId": "string",
"outRefundId": "string",
"refundType": "string",
"status": "string",
"orderInfo": {
"tid": "string",
"outTid": "string",
"payType": 0,
"expressType": 0,
"type": 0,
"refundState": 0,
"updateTime": "2019-08-24T14:15:22Z",
"consignTime": "2019-08-24T14:15:22Z",
"payTime": "2019-08-24T14:15:22Z",
"successTime": "2019-08-24T14:15:22Z",
"closeType": 0,
"payTypeStr": "string",
"channelType": 0,
"status": "string",
"created": "2019-08-24T14:15:22Z",
"packingChargeInfo": {
"name": "string",
"realPay": 0,
"pay": 0,
"refundable": true,
"originPay": 0,
"extInfo": {
"packagingFeeType": 0,
"itemsFeeDetails": [
{
"price": 0,
"count": 0,
"name": "string"
}
]
}
}
},
"buyerInfo": {
"outerUserId": "string",
"buyerPhone": "string",
"buyerId": 0,
"nickname": "string",
"yzOpenId": "string",
"outOpenId": "string"
},
"sellerInfo": {
"nodeKdtId": 0,
"shopDisplayNo": "string",
"shopName": "string",
"outStoreId": "string",
"outStoreCode": "string",
"tel": "string"
},
"subOrders": [
{
"itemIdentity": {
"itemId": 0,
"rootItemId": 0,
"outItemId": "string",
"itemNo": "string",
"itemBarcode": "string",
"skuNo": "string",
"skuId": 0,
"rootSkuId": 0,
"outSkuId": "string",
"skuBarcode": "string",
"skuUniqueCode": "string"
},
"alias": "string",
"totalFee": 0,
"num": 0,
"oid": "string",
"outOid": "string",
"buyerMessages": "string",
"pointsPrice": "string",
"price": 0,
"isPresent": true,
"promotionDiscount": "string",
"goodsCostPrice": 0,
"itemType": 0,
"title": "string",
"picPath": "string",
"payment": 0,
"discountPrice": 0,
"weight": 0,
"itemSalesStaffs": [
{
"staffNo": "string",
"outGuideId": "string",
"yzGuideId": "string",
"rate": 0
}
],
"skuAttributes": [
{
"value": "string",
"name": "string"
}
],
"itemProps": "string"
}
]
}
返回响应
🟢200成功
application/json
Body
success
boolean
可选
code
integer
可选
message
string
可选
requestId
string
请求Id
errorData
object (Map«Object»)
调用失败返回的数据
key
object (key)
可选
data
object (OrderRefundStatusChangeExtResponse)
调用返回的数据
success
boolean
必需
示例
{
"success": false,
"code": 0,
"message": "",
"requestId": "",
"errorData": {
"": {}
},
"data": {
"success": false
}
}